+Subject: Revert "thermal/drivers/mediatek: Use devm_of_iomap to avoid resource leak in mtk_thermal_probe"
+MIME-Version: 1.0
+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8
+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it
+
+From: Ricardo Cañuelo <ricardo.canuelo@collabora.com>
+
+commit 86edac7d3888c715fe3a81bd61f3617ecfe2e1dd upstream.
+
+This reverts commit f05c7b7d9ea9477fcc388476c6f4ade8c66d2d26.
+
+That change was causing a regression in the generic-adc-thermal-probed
+bootrr test as reported in the kernelci-results list [1].
+A proper rework will take longer, so revert it for now.
